Sleep

Nuxt 3 Dependable Launch - All the details coming from Nuxt Nation 2022

.If you have been actually following the big buzz all around the technician space and Vue.js community then you know that Nuxt Labs discharged a stable model of Nuxt 3 at Nuxt Country, the biggest on-line Nuxt meeting. I existed and also the sensation was remarkable.Within this write-up, our company'll speak all about the only discharged Nuxt 3. Our company are going to cover all the relevant information given in the keynote pep talk by Sebastien Chopin the maker of Nuxt at Nuxt Nation 2022.Keeping that, let's begin!Nuxt is an internet platform for producing Vue.js application. Nuxt could be used to develop Single webpage/ multipage (SPAs or MPAs) requests or Server/ Pre-rendered (SSR/ SSG) Applications.Nuxt additionally launches Crossbreed rendering where our company can set up some web pages to be server rendered as well as others to become customer rendered.Nuxt 3 started its own beta stage last Oct as well as after 400 days, 29000 commits on Github, as well as 320 contributors a stable version of Nuxt 3 has actually been actually released.What is actually various in Nuxt 3.Lets check out at several of Nuxt 3's new enhancements and also what makes it various coming from Nuxt 2.Nuxt 3 uses Vue 3. This delivers away from the box support for the structure API, better efficiency, as well as more.Nuxt 3 makes use of a h3 web server which is an upgrade from the link internet server in Nuxt 2. H3 is actually a very little structure built on leading of unjs for high performance and may do work in multiple atmospheres.Nuxt 3 utilizes Vite for packing and also can also support webpack 5 via a plugin.Uses Vue-router 4.Uses composable VueUse Scalp to manage meta records and s.e.o.A Hosting server( much less) packager Nitro.Much smaller sized as well as lighter Bundle measurements.Along with the 34.1 kB dimension for Nuxt 3, Vue.js takes 25.3 kB as well as Nuxt makes use of the remaining 8.7 kB for.App Entry with Moisture.Root element along with.Universal as well as light in weight router useRouter(), middleware, and also.Move composables and also parts like useHead(),,, as well as for search engine optimisation and social sharing.Universal data getting with $fetch().Default 400 as well as 500 mistake pages.Plugins and also runtimeConfig logic.useNuxtApp() composable as well as hooks app: created, app: positioned, webpage: start for fastening in to Nuxt lifecycle. Useful for developing changes and also loading computer animations.All these wrapped in merely a 8.7 kB JS data.Nuxt 3 still carries a few of the remarkable components from Nuxt 2 to continue providing designers that spectacular Nuxt experience.It's blazingly quickly.Offers Combination rendering to define whether your webpages should be actually web server edge provided or statically made utilizing caching.It is actually fantastic for s.e.o.This makes Nuxt 3 a strong web platform to develop any sort of contemporary site. Uniting solitary webpage treatments (Day spas) and Server-Side Rendered (SSR) Treatments with hybrid rendering where our company can apply various option guidelines to our web pages.Nuxt 3 additionally generates a brand-new access apply for our project, app.vue which isn't existing in Nuxt 2.A/ designs directory site is likewise current,.A/ pages option which takes a new phrase structure for generating vibrant paths ([ i.d.] vue).A/ parts directory site that includes vehicle import to import all components developed around the world.An/ possession directory for your font styles, vectors and media.A/ composable directory to produce your composables with the Composition API. Additionally auto imported in Nuxt 3.A/ hosting server directory to make web server options and apis.Spectacular modules you may include in your Nuxt app (I18n, Tailwind, picture, Material, and so on).A/ material listing to incorporate fall information our team can easily make use of along with Nuxt web content. Titular acknowledgment to Nuxt Content, an excellent module where you can include markdown to your Nuxt application as Vue.js parts. Very helpful in generating documents web pages.Nuxt Extends.Nuxt 3 presents another fantastic function, in the course of launch, referred to as extends where you essentially can extend other Nuxt apps into your Nuxt project. Sebastien gave an instance with open-source task Nuxt Typography.Nuxt Typography is actually a Nuxt concept to receive a stunning as well as customisable typography with a set of writing components for Nuxt Content. Its own basically creating css with JavaScript.I am actually extremely excited o observe what new tasks will certainly surface from this brand-new prolongs attribute.Docus.Docus is actually a basic and also user-friendly device that aids you make blazing swift progressive web applications powered by NuxtJS. The purpose is actually for the designer to have fewer choices to create and also to get rid of must configure every element of internet site advancement. All you need to perform is actually create your material in MDC syntax (MDC = Accounting allowance + elements) as well as Docus does the rest.It is actually a fantastic device to create information along with Nuxt 3.Nuxt Workshop.Nuxt laboratories is in the procedure of releasing Nuxt Studio, where websites can be developed on-line using themes or even from a repository on Github, collaborate along with our team to revise web content, and release along with a solitary click. Nuxt Typography and also Docus are actually preserved using studio.Nuxt Center is currently in Beta stage so you can register to obtain beta accessibility.Conclusion.I individually took pleasure in viewing Sebastien speak about Nuxt 3 as well as the future for this incredible framework as well as I wish you additionally enjoyed reading this brief coming from his speech. Nuxt 3 is actually the perfect platform to create any kind of modern internet application, therefore if you are actually looking to start utilizing Nuxt 3, have a look at the Nuxt 3 basics program on Vue University. It possesses everything you require to construct your initial Nuxt 3 use. If you are actually looking for even more substantial learning component to be a Nuxt 3 pro, at that point sign up for Mastering Nuxt 3 which will offer you a detailed walkthrough on the Nuxt 3 ecological community as you develop a production-ready full pile application.See Sebastien's full keynote pep talk on youtube.Sebastien Chopin Speak.